服务器测试方法有哪些,深入解析服务器测试方法,全面提升系统稳定性与性能
- 综合资讯
- 2024-12-14 23:55:09
- 1

服务器测试方法包括性能测试、压力测试、稳定性测试等,通过深入解析这些方法,可以全面提升系统稳定性与性能。...
服务器测试方法包括性能测试、压力测试、稳定性测试等,通过深入解析这些方法,可以全面提升系统稳定性与性能。
随着信息技术的飞速发展,服务器已成为企业信息化建设的重要基础设施,服务器稳定性、性能和安全性直接影响到企业的业务运行和用户体验,对服务器进行全面的测试,确保其稳定、高效运行,至关重要,本文将详细介绍服务器测试方法,帮助您全面提升系统稳定性与性能。
服务器测试方法
1、性能测试
(1)CPU性能测试
CPU是服务器的心脏,其性能直接关系到服务器处理任务的效率,常用的CPU性能测试工具有:
- AIDA64:一款综合性能测试软件,可测试CPU的浮点运算、整数运算、内存带宽等性能指标。
- CPU-Z:一款硬件检测软件,可查看CPU的详细信息,包括核心数、线程数、主频、缓存等。
(2)内存性能测试
内存是服务器处理数据的重要载体,内存性能直接影响服务器性能,常用的内存性能测试工具有:
- MemTest86:一款开源的内存测试软件,可检测内存的稳定性。
- Windows内存诊断工具:Windows系统自带的一款内存测试工具,可检测内存的稳定性、错误率等。
(3)硬盘性能测试
硬盘是服务器存储数据的重要设备,硬盘性能直接影响数据读写速度,常用的硬盘性能测试工具有:
- CrystalDiskMark:一款开源的硬盘性能测试软件,可测试硬盘的读写速度、4K对齐等性能指标。
- AS SSD Benchmark:一款硬盘性能测试软件,可测试硬盘的连续读写速度、4K对齐等性能指标。
2、稳定性测试
(1)压力测试
压力测试用于评估服务器在极限负载下的性能和稳定性,常用的压力测试工具有:
- Apache JMeter:一款开源的负载测试工具,可模拟大量用户访问服务器,测试服务器性能。
- LoadRunner:一款商业的负载测试工具,功能强大,支持多种测试场景。
(2)24小时在线测试
将服务器连续运行24小时,观察服务器运行状况,包括CPU、内存、硬盘等硬件资源的使用情况,以及系统日志、错误信息等,以评估服务器的稳定性。
3、安全性测试
(1)漏洞扫描
使用漏洞扫描工具对服务器进行安全检测,找出潜在的安全隐患,常用的漏洞扫描工具有:
- Nessus:一款开源的漏洞扫描工具,功能强大,支持多种操作系统。
- OpenVAS:一款开源的漏洞扫描工具,可检测系统、应用等层面的安全漏洞。
(2)入侵检测
使用入侵检测工具监控服务器网络流量,发现可疑行为,预防恶意攻击,常用的入侵检测工具有:
- Snort:一款开源的入侵检测工具,可检测网络流量中的恶意攻击。
- Suricata:一款开源的入侵检测工具,功能强大,支持多种检测模式。
4、用户体验测试
(1)响应速度测试
测试服务器在不同负载下的响应速度,确保用户在使用过程中获得良好的体验。
(2)功能测试
测试服务器各项功能是否正常,包括数据备份、恢复、备份策略等。
服务器测试是确保系统稳定、高效运行的重要环节,通过对服务器进行全面的性能、稳定性、安全性和用户体验测试,可以有效提升系统性能,降低故障率,为企业提供可靠、安全的服务,在实际操作中,应根据企业需求选择合适的测试方法,确保服务器在满足业务需求的同时,提供优质的用户体验。
本文链接:https://www.zhitaoyun.cn/1564592.html
发表评论